Jacobin pigeon is another beautiful pigeon recognized for its unique muff or cowl of feathers that addresses its head and neck. This hood gives the bird a distinctive physical appearance just like a french monk who's called the Jacobin monk. That’s why the bird is called the Jacobin pigeon.
